JACINTHE sailing schooners (1823-1826)

Names

Jacinthe

Jonquille

Émeraude

Topaze

Rose

Anémone

Mutine

Légère

Builders

Arsenal de Toulon: Jacinthe, Jonquille

Arsenal de Cherbourg: Émeraude, Topaze

Bayonne: Rose, Anémone

Arsenal de Lorient: Mutine, Légère

Completed

1823: Jacinthe, Jonquille, Émeraude, Topaze, Rose, Anémone

1825: Mutine

1826: Légère

Losses

Jonquille (wrecked 17.2.1830), Topaze (wrecked 11.6.1838), Rose (earthquake 8.2.1843), Anémone (wrecked 8.10.1824), Légère (13.6.1850)

Transfers

none

Discarding

1841: Jacinthe, Mutine

1843: Émeraude
